Distance From Skuit Drift Airport to Naha Airport / JASDF Naha Air Base

The distance from Skuit Drift Airport () to Naha Airport / JASDF Naha Air Base (OKA) is 8075 miles or 12996 kilometers or 7013 nautical miles.

How long does it take to travel from Skuit Drift ( Namibia ) to Naha ( Japan )?

A one-way nonstop (direct) flight between Skuit Drift and Naha takes around 18 hours 33 minutes.
Estimated flight time from Skuit Drift Airport, Skuit Drift, Namibia to Naha Airport / JASDF Naha Air Base, Naha, Japan is 18 hours 33 minutes under avarage conditions. Your actual flying time may vary depending on wind direction/speed or weather conditions. This calculation does not include the departure and landing times of the aircraft. Why should you arrive 3 hours before international flight? Flyers who are traveling to an international destination should arrive at the airport earlier than domestic flyers. This is because international flights can have additional check-in requirements, like passport verification, that need to be completed before you receive your boarding pass.
